Ultimate Volleyball Club Expansion Approved In Frankfort

The sports facility will expand into more suites in its building for space for strength training and offices.

FRANKFORT, IL — Ultimate Volleyball will move forward with an expansion after the Frankfort Village Board approved a special use permit for the business, at its Monday board meeting.

The sports facility, which has operated at 10850 W. Laraway Road for over 20 years at the main indoor sports field, will expand into suites 1-3 W for more strength training and office space areas.

Volleyball play would still occur in the arena area, not in suites 1-3 W, board documents state.

At an April public hearing, nearby residents expressed concerns with traffic and parking from tournaments at the Heritage Sports Plaza, according to board documents. With the approval of the special use permit, there is a condition that all activities occur within the building itself and no volleyball tournaments will be held at the location.

Trustee Michael Leddin said the police department would continue to gather data on traffic and revisit the issue if need be.

Ultimate Volleyball Club provides advanced training and competition for grade school and high school athletes, according to the club's website. Its home facilities are located in Frankfort and Mokena.
